Setting the Digital Zoom
This feature controls the digital zoom mode of your 
camera. 
Your camera enlarges an image using the optical 
zoom first. When the zoom scale exceeds 5x, the 
camera uses digital zoom. 
To set Digital Zoom
1. From the Record men, select Digital Zoom.

Setting the Date Stamp
The Date Stamp function allows you to add the recorded date and time on your 
photos.
The recording date and time are based on your camera’s clock settings. Once date 
and time are stamped on a photo, they can no longer be edited or deleted.
